University Of Maine At Augusta

The University of Maine at Augusta is located in Augusta, Maine. It is a part of the University of Maine System. It was founded in 1965 as a continuing education division of the University of Maine. UMA offers a wide variety of degrees and programs in diverse areas of study. UMA is nationally recognized for offering an online bachelor's degree in information and library science. The university is organized into the following academic divisions:

  • College of Arts & Humanities
  • College of Mathematics & Professional Studies
  • College of Natural & Social Sciences

UMA’s athletic department fields both men's and women’s sports teams, which participate in basketball, hockey, baseball, softball, swimming & diving and soccer, among others. UMA is a member of the Yankee Small College Conference and the United States Collegiate Athletic Association.

Overview of University Of Maine At Augusta

University Of Maine At Augusta is in a town not particularly near any major cities, in Augusta, ME. The school is classified as a public college. Students at University Of Maine At Augusta earn degrees up to the Post-Baccalaureate certificate.

Areas of Study

The most common major fields study at the school include therapy and counseling.

University Of Maine At Augusta Selectivity

All qualified applicants are admitted as University Of Maine At Augusta offers open admission. The school attracts a fair number of students from out of state.

Faculty

Some professors at University Of Maine At Augusta are awarded tenure, allowing the school to retain good faculty members.

Student Body

The school, in 2007, had 5,101 students (2,964 full-time equivalent). Adults changing careers are relatively common at University Of Maine At Augusta.
